Contribute
Register

[Success] b1's "Mac Mini Killer" with macOS Mojave: i7-8700 | Gigabyte Z370N | RX560 | 16GB RAM

I feel a little bad because it was me who recommended some of your components (although I mentioned that the Noctua had limitations even with my processor). But I definitely second @b166ar's suggestion to try undervolting. It's pretty easy, cost-free, and is guaranteed to lower your cpu temperatures by a few degrees. Even a conservative 50mv undervolt on my CPU helped the temperatures to remain under 77C in all intensive tasks (in my case games). You should definitely give it a try. Take a look at this post to see how it's done in the Z370N WiFi.
Don't be, I have another macOS based mini-itx media center/server in mind for future, so this l9i cooler will definitely be a good choice for some i3 or i5.

I guess that will try undervolting these days, but again summer in Shanghai is crazy hot, even with AC turned on ambiance temp normally above 25°C, so if NH-l12 will fit I'll leave it there for good.Thanks for the link.

GPU: Personally, I replaced the fans of my RX580 with two Noctua 120mm. It was something along the lines of this mod. Well frankly, the final result was not very aesthetically pleasant... Even the temperature drop was not that high: around 6C - maximum of 79C in games now as opposed to 85C before. However, the real difference is noise-wise: the Noctua fans barely spin and when they do, they're literally inaudible. However, try this mod only if you want to keep your VGA for a really long time, because you won't be able to sell it :lol:, unless you restore the original fans.
Wow, that's so cool, I might do it once the warranty on my card is over, but before I can live with it pretty happily as well: when I edit I use headphones, when I play games - the sound effects of the game usually way louder than fan noise, while GPU is working with less than 50% of the load the fans either not spinning at all or dead silent.
Case: since your case supports two case fans, I recommend setting them as exhaust rather than intake (if you're not doing it already). The rationale behind it is that small cases like yours (and mine) work better with negative air pressure. In other words, it's more effective to get rid of the hot air and allow fresh air in through the grill holes than the opposite. This experiment highlights the difference in temperature caused by the orientation of the case fans. The tests were done in a Node 202 case, but the same should apply to your case.
You probably haven't noticed the picture in one of my previous posts:

There are two silent 92mm PWM case fans on the top, I purchased them separately and they help a lot with getting rid of that hot air inside of the case:

CPU and GPU fans: intake
Top 92mm fans: exhaust
 
@inarush @serg1892 they banned me because of my Github link, where they found a donation section :roll2: I deleted it.

If something happens, you can always follow my updates on the Github.
 
Last edited:
So @b166ar, I have a question. You dual-boot your hackintosh with Windows 10, don't you? I am planning to purchase one extra M.2 SSD to install Windows on. First question is: the rear M.2 slot for SSD in our motherboard only supports NVMe drives, no SATA at all right?

The main M.2 slot (with the heatsink) supports SATA and PCIe M.2. The second slot is PCIe only. So, if you are going to buy SATA M.2, you will have to move your macOS drive to the back of the motherboard. And M.2 may become very hot without a heatsink. I had to buy an additional heatsink for this drive, and my max temps dropped from 70C to 55C.

Second question is: once I get the drive, can I just install Windows on it and Clover will automatically recognize both systems? Or do I have to configure something first?

Clover will recognize both systems automatically.
 
@inarush @serg1892 they banned me because of my Github link, where they found a donation section :roll2: I deleted it.

If something happens, you can always follow my updates on the Github.

Sorry to hear that. I think some of the rules here are over-reinforced, but perhaps the staff have their reasons...

The main M.2 slot (with the heatsink) supports SATA and PCIe M.2. The second slot is PCIe only. So, if you are going to buy SATA M.2, you will have to move your macOS drive to the back of the motherboard. And M.2 may become very hot without a heatsink. I had to buy an additional heatsink for this drive, and my max temps dropped from 70C to 55C.

Clover will recognize both systems automatically.

I ended up purchasing a cheap 256 GB NVMe drive just to install Windows and some games. It was placed on the rear slot, but I was able to install Windows only after disabling all other drives, just like @serg1892 had suggested. After installation, I re-plugged the other storage units and Clover correctly identified the Windows drive. Dual-boot working fine in my Hack. :thumbup:

It is definitely running hot, though. I will have to get a heatsink as well.
 
The main M.2 slot (with the heatsink) supports SATA and PCIe M.2. The second slot is PCIe only. So, if you are going to buy SATA M.2, you will have to move your macOS drive to the back of the motherboard. And M.2 may become very hot without a heatsink. I had to buy an additional heatsink for this drive, and my max temps dropped from 70C to 55C.

I use two Samsung 970 EVO. The 500GB NVMe on the top side under the MOBO's heatsink and a 250GB NVMe on the back side. The boot drive is the 250GB and the home directory is the 500GB. The 970 EVO comes with heat sink (thin layer of copper laminated on the chips) I only have 6C temp difference. 49C vs 55C

Check your airflow it might be blocked on the back of the MOBO!
 
The 970 EVO comes with heat sink (thin layer of copper laminated on the chips)

I don't think that "heat sink" is a correct definition for copper sticker :)

Check your airflow it might be blocked on the back of the MOBO!

SFF case, so zero airflow.
 
b166r,

I have a problem with your new SSDT-EC. My BenQ monitor has an SD card reader connected through an USB port. With the new SSDT-EC it is not recognised (nothing happens) however with my previous SSDT-UIAC it was working fine.

Had a quick look at it and seen SSDT-EC has dependencies, which file should I look at?
See my previous SSDT-UIAC attached - only use back panel USBs
 

Attachments

  • Back_Panel_USB only_SSDT-UIAC.aml
    699 bytes · Views: 74
b166r,

I have a problem with your new SSDT-EC. My BenQ monitor has an SD card reader connected through an USB port. With the new SSDT-EC it is not recognised (nothing happens) however with my previous SSDT-UIAC it was working fine.

Had a quick look at it and seen SSDT-EC has dependencies, which file should I look at?
See my previous SSDT-UIAC attached - only use back panel USBs

Did you copy USBPorts.kext to you /L/E/ or Other folder?
 
Did you copy USBPorts.kext to you /L/E/ or Other folder?
Yep, I have it in the /L/E/ folder.
There was a conflict with USBInjectAll which is not needed anymore. After removing USBInjectAll everything is working fine.
 
Last edited:
Hello there, I would like to ask you if wake up works as expected. I have same motherboard, on Vanilla install but have problem with wake up, few time works but most I get black screen with LCD on, or keyboard and mouse frizzed.
 
Back
Top